While not as important as a slow sim using real game physics, I would like to see a hike to hike mode put in the game. Basically, the huddles are removed and the time it takes for the huddle is subtracted off the clock. So the ball is snapped, play run, then players are on the line of scrimmage waiting for next snap. I have no desire to see players huddle up. Its necessary in real life, but not in our fictional world [;)]. I'd rather shorten the time it takes to watch a game a bit then have this piece of realism.
